Babysense II includes two sensor panels, which fit safely under the mattress and constantly senses and responds to baby’s breathing and movement. Breathing motions trigger a green flashing light. If the baby stops breathing for more than 20 seconds or if the breathing rate drops below 10 breaths in a minute, a loud alarm is sounded.
These could be signs of something easily fixed like the baby rolling face down or against the side of the cot. Babysense II is an Australian Standards Compliant and Therapeutic Goods Administration approved Medical device used in worldwide homes and hospitals for over 10 years. Monitoring is done without touching the baby. The sensors are connected to s small battery operated control unit clipped to the side of baby’s bed. There is no connection to any electrical outlet.
